My favorite technique is to use a liquid fertilizer at half strength in 
three applications - if I am organized (rare occurrence) that would be 
pre-bloom but well leafed out, post bloom, and three to four weeks after 
the flowers fade but before leaves yellow.

I like Jack's Classic Blossom Booster, which has a 10-30-20 analysis.

It is absorbed through the leaves as well as taken up by roots so I mix 
and just slosh over the plants using a watering can. Very good when 
lifting, dividing, and replanting bulbs still in leaf.
